WATCHDOG MEETS LONDON 2012 ORGANISING COMMITTEE

London 2012 officials were in positive mood after their first meeting with the International Olympic Committee's Coordination Commission.

The commission's chair Dennis Oswald met with London 2012 chairman Sebastian Coe ahead of a full commission visit next year.

"It was an excellent start to our relationship," said Coe, after working through a 'comprehensive agenda.'

The commission will oversee the organising committee's work in the run-up to the 2012 Games.

Coe said Oswald was positive about the early work that has already been done, and the commitment to producing a long-term sporting legacy.

Oswald carried out the same supervisory role ahead of the Athens Olympics in 2004.
